42 lines
No EOL
1.1 KiB
Text
42 lines
No EOL
1.1 KiB
Text
<% if @total == 0 %>
|
|
|
|
<p>Keine gefunden</p>
|
|
|
|
<% else %>
|
|
|
|
<p>Anzahl gefundener Transaktionen: <b><%= @total %></b></p>
|
|
|
|
<p>
|
|
<%= pagination_links_remote @financial_transactions, :update => 'transactions',
|
|
:params => {:sort => params[:sort], :query => params['query']}%>
|
|
</p>
|
|
|
|
|
|
<table>
|
|
<thead>
|
|
<tr>
|
|
<td <%= sort_td_class_helper "date" %>>
|
|
<%= sort_link_helper "Datum", "date" %>
|
|
</td>
|
|
<td>Wer</td>
|
|
<td <%= sort_td_class_helper "note" %>>
|
|
<%= sort_link_helper "Notiz", "note" %>
|
|
</td>
|
|
<td <%= sort_td_class_helper "amount" %>>
|
|
<%= sort_link_helper "Betrag", "amount" %>
|
|
</td>
|
|
</tr>
|
|
</thead>
|
|
<tbody>
|
|
<% @financial_transactions.each do |t| %>
|
|
<tr class="<%= cycle("even","odd") %>">
|
|
<td><%= format_time(t.created_on) %></td>
|
|
<td><%=h t.user.nil? ? '??' : t.user.nick %></td>
|
|
<td><%=h t.note %></td>
|
|
<td style="color:<%= t.amount < 0 ? 'red' : 'black' %>; width:5em" class="currency"><%= number_to_currency(t.amount) %></td>
|
|
</tr>
|
|
<% end %>
|
|
</tbody>
|
|
</table>
|
|
|
|
<% end %> |